Location Requirements
NOTE: This microwave oven is intended for installation over a 
countertop. Do not install this microwave oven over any heat 
source, such as a range or cooktop.
Check the opening where the microwave oven will be installed. 
The location must provide:
Minimum cabinet depth of 12" (30.5 cm).
Minimum cabinet lower shelf thickness of 3/16" (5 mm).
Support for weight of at least 50 lbs (22.7 kg), in addition to 
the normal contents of the cabinet, as well as any items that 
might be hanging from the bottom of the cabinet.
Grounded electrical outlet inside upper cabinet. See 
“Electrical Requirements” section.
To allow for adequate ventilation, which is important for 
product performance, a clearance of at least 2
¹⁄₂" (6.4 cm) 
must exist between the microwave oven and a side wall (or 
cabinetry wall) on each side.
